Chemistry: Exploring the Three Realms

Chemistry, a central science, encompasses the study of matter and its interactions. It's divided into three main disciplines, each shedding light on a unique aspect of our physical world:

  1. Organic Chemistry Organic chemistry focuses on the study of carbon-based compounds that are essential to life. Carbon atoms can form intricate networks through strong covalent bonds, providing the backbone to molecules like sugars, proteins, and DNA. Organic chemistry explores the synthesis, structure, and properties of these compounds and their reactions. It's this field that gives us the tools to create new medicines, materials, and fuels.

  2. Inorganic Chemistry Inorganic chemistry deals with elements not containing carbon, such as metals and non-metals, and their compounds. It's a vast field, encompassing the study of materials like iron, aluminum, and nitrogen, along with their reactions and properties. Inorganic chemistry is indispensable to our modern technology, providing the basis for developments in electronics, energy storage, and catalysis.

  3. Physical Chemistry Physical chemistry combines the principles of physics with the study of matter, focusing on the behavior of atoms and molecules at the microscopic level. It explores the relationships between energy, thermodynamics, and the properties of substances. Physical chemistry is crucial to understanding the mechanisms underlying chemical reactions, phase transitions, and the behavior of materials under various conditions. This field underpins our understanding of chemical processes and provides a theoretical foundation for the development of new technologies.

Each of these subdisciplines interacts and overlaps, providing a comprehensive understanding of the natural world. For example:

  • Organic chemists use physical chemistry principles to study the electronic structure of molecules and their interactions, while inorganic chemists employ physical chemistry concepts to understand the behavior of materials and their properties.
  • Inorganic chemists study the synthesis and properties of catalysts, which are essential to understanding and controlling chemical reactions, a fundamental aspect of physical chemistry.
  • Organic chemists explore the synthesis and reactions of molecules with biological relevance, which is crucial to our understanding of life's processes and physical chemistry's role in biochemistry.

The interdisciplinary nature of chemistry provides fertile ground for innovation and discovery, driving progress in fields as diverse as medicine, energy, and materials science. Chemistry's three main subdisciplines, working in harmony, continue to expand our knowledge of matter and its interactions, paving the way for a brighter and more sustainable future.
